For decades, the American dream home was a big house on a big lot. But the mortgage crisis has made it clear that many of our dream homes will be out of reach for quite some time. So what should a realistic dream home look like now? Architect Roger Lewis takes on that question and gives us a tour of his house in Washington's Palisades neighborhood.
